Artificial Intelligence (AI) Drawing is a cutting-edge technology that utilizes artificial intelligence algorithms to create images, illustrations, and artwork based on input from users. This technology has gained substantial traction in recent years, transforming how artists, designers, and everyday users approach creativity and visual expression. By leveraging machine learning techniques, AI Drawing tools can interpret user prompts, styles, and preferences to generate unique visual content. This article delves into the meaning, context, and relevance of AI Drawing, exploring its historical evolution, current trends, and practical applications in the modern tech landscape.

Understanding AI Drawing

AI Drawing can be best understood as a fusion of art and technology, where algorithms are trained on vast datasets of images to learn patterns, styles, and artistic techniques. These systems employ deep learning, a subset of machine learning, which enables them to analyze and generate complex visual content. When users provide input—be it text descriptions, sketches, or stylistic preferences—AI Drawing tools can produce artwork that reflects the user’s intent, often with surprising creativity.

The significance of AI Drawing extends beyond mere convenience; it challenges traditional notions of authorship and creativity. As these tools become more sophisticated, they raise questions about the role of the artist in the creative process. Is the creator the artist who inputs the prompt, or does the AI itself deserve recognition for its output? Such debates are essential in understanding the implications of AI in artistic communities and industries.

A Historical Overview of AI in Art

The integration of artificial intelligence in art is not a new phenomenon. The roots of AI Drawing can be traced back to the mid-20th century when researchers began exploring the intersection of computer science and creative expression. Early experiments involved rudimentary algorithms that could generate simple patterns and shapes, laying the groundwork for future developments.

In the 1980s and 1990s, advancements in computer graphics and computational power allowed artists to experiment with digital art forms. During this period, tools such as Adobe Photoshop and CorelDRAW emerged, enabling artists to manipulate images with unprecedented flexibility. However, these tools required manual input and artistic skill, limiting accessibility for those without formal training.

The emergence of machine learning in the 21st century marked a turning point for AI Drawing. Researchers developed neural networks that could learn from vast datasets of images, enabling machines to recognize and replicate artistic styles. Notable breakthroughs included the advent of Generative Adversarial Networks (GANs) in 2014, which allowed for the creation of highly realistic images through a process of competition between two neural networks. This innovation paved the way for AI tools capable of generating artwork that closely resembles human creations.

Today, AI Drawing has become increasingly mainstream, with numerous applications across various industries. Creative professionals, businesses, and hobbyists alike are harnessing the power of AI to enhance their artistic endeavors. Several key trends illustrate the growing significance of AI Drawing in modern technology.

1. User-Friendly Tools

A surge of user-friendly AI Drawing applications has emerged, allowing individuals with little to no artistic training to create stunning visuals. Platforms like DALL-E, Midjourney, and Artbreeder enable users to generate artwork by simply inputting text prompts or selecting desired styles. These tools democratize creativity, making it accessible to a broader audience and fostering a new wave of digital artists.

2. Integration with Traditional Art Forms

AI Drawing is not confined to digital platforms; it is increasingly being integrated into traditional art practices. Artists are utilizing AI-generated imagery as a foundation for their work, blending human creativity with machine-generated content. This collaboration enriches the creative process, allowing for innovative explorations of style, texture, and form.

3. Personalization and Customization

One of the most exciting aspects of AI Drawing is its ability to adapt to individual preferences. Many AI tools allow users to customize outputs based on specific styles, colors, or themes. This level of personalization enhances the user experience, as individuals can create artwork that resonates with their unique tastes and aesthetics.

4. Commercial Applications

Businesses have recognized the potential of AI Drawing for marketing and branding purposes. Companies are leveraging AI-generated visuals for product design, advertising campaigns, and social media content. By streamlining the creative process, businesses can produce high-quality visuals at a fraction of the cost and time traditionally required for manual design work.

Real-World Applications of AI Drawing

The impact of AI Drawing extends beyond artistic expression, influencing various sectors in the technology landscape. Its applications are diverse, ranging from entertainment and gaming to education and healthcare.

1. Entertainment and Media

In the entertainment industry, AI Drawing is revolutionizing animation and game design. Studios are experimenting with AI-generated characters and environments, speeding up the production process and enhancing the creative possibilities. AI tools can assist animators by generating background art or concept designs, allowing for more time to refine character movements and narratives.

2. Education and Training

AI Drawing tools offer valuable resources for educators and students alike. In art education, these applications can serve as teaching aids, helping students understand various artistic styles and techniques. Additionally, AI can provide instant feedback on student work, enabling personalized learning experiences. This integration of technology into the classroom fosters creativity and encourages students to experiment with new visual mediums.

3. Healthcare and Medical Imaging

The healthcare sector is also exploring the potential of AI Drawing through applications in medical imaging and visualization. AI algorithms can analyze medical data and generate visual representations of complex information, aiding in diagnosis and treatment planning. This intersection of art and science enhances communication between healthcare professionals and patients, making medical information more accessible and understandable.

Challenges and Ethical Considerations

While AI Drawing presents numerous advantages, it also raises important ethical questions and challenges. As the technology continues to advance, it is crucial for stakeholders in the art and tech industries to address these concerns.

One of the most pressing issues surrounding AI-generated artwork is the question of copyright and ownership. If an AI creates an artwork based on a user’s input, who holds the rights to that image? The lack of clear legal frameworks regarding AI-generated content complicates matters, and artists may find themselves navigating a complex landscape of intellectual property rights.

2. The Role of Human Creativity

As AI Drawing tools become more sophisticated, there is a concern that they may diminish the value of human creativity. While AI can produce high-quality visuals, it lacks the emotional depth and context that human artists bring to their work. Striking a balance between leveraging AI as a tool and preserving the significance of human artistic expression is essential for the future of the creative industries.

3. Potential for Misuse

The accessibility of AI Drawing tools also raises concerns about misuse. Individuals may exploit these technologies to create misleading or harmful content, such as deepfakes or inappropriate imagery. As AI continues to evolve, it is imperative for developers and users to adhere to ethical guidelines and best practices to mitigate the risk of misuse.

The Future of AI Drawing

Looking ahead, the future of AI Drawing is poised for significant growth and innovation. As technology continues to advance, we can expect to see further enhancements in the capabilities of AI algorithms, leading to even more realistic and complex artwork generation. Additionally, collaborations between artists and AI systems are likely to become more common, resulting in hybrid forms of artistic expression that challenge traditional boundaries.

The integration of AI Drawing into various sectors will also expand, with new applications emerging in fields such as virtual reality, augmented reality, and interactive media. These developments will create exciting opportunities for artists, designers, and technologists to collaborate and push the boundaries of creativity.

In conclusion, AI Drawing represents a transformative force in the intersection of technology and art. As we navigate the evolving landscape of creativity, it is essential to embrace the potential of AI while remaining mindful of the ethical implications and challenges it presents. By fostering a collaborative approach that values both human creativity and technological innovation, we can unlock new possibilities for artistic expression in the digital age.
